The Ahuriri River is a river in the Waitaki District of the Canterbury region on New Zealand's South Island . Especially in the lower reaches it is an intertwined river .

geography

The upper course lies on the eastern flank of the Southern Alps . The river flows 70 km through the southernmost part of the Mackenzie Basin before it reaches Lake Benmore , one of the reservoirs of the hydropower project on the Waitaki . It unites here with the Waitaki, which eventually flows into the Pacific .

Shortly before its confluence with the lake, the New Zealand State Highway 8 crosses the river, the State Highway 83 approximately follows the middle and lower reaches of the Ahuriri. The place Omarama is about 6 km west of the mouth. It is the only place on the river.
